Namibia: Junior Table Tennis On the Rebound

THE Namibian National Youth Table Tennis championships were held last Saturday, at the JLT Beukes Primary School, in Rehoboth.

The tournament, organised by the Namibian Table Tennis Association (NTTA), was enjoyed by over 50 juniors from Windhoek, Rehoboth and Mariental.

The Deutsche Höhere Privatschule (DHPS) of Windhoek showed their strength, when there young team of players took six out of the eight available quarter final spots in the singles event and three of the four semi-final spots in the doubles event.

Mariental's Danville Mouton clinched the boy's singles section of the championship in a tightly contested final as he defeated Danville Yannick Pape of Deutsche Höhere Privatschule (DHPS) in four sets. Dennis Schreiber also representing DHPS and Romanus Kanyanga from Mariental were both defeated semi-finalists.

In a nail-biting doubles final, DHPS's Jakob Machleidt and Dennis Schreiber came out victorious when they defeated Govany Isaacs and Danville Mouton by three sets to one.

The plate event was won by Marco Clarke of Mariental and runner-up was Hardly Farmer from M&K Gertze High School.

Antoinette van Wyk (M&K Gertze High School) took the title in the girls section when she beat Samantha Dentlinger (Dr Lemmer High School) in the final. A total of eight girls participated in the championships.
